A Tutorial that Starts from Scratch

I’d like to see a very basic tutorial that explains how to put on a “face” for work or a date. I’m talking, don’t tell me to blend, show and tell me what “blend” means in a makeup context. Tell me how to apply foundation, concealer, etc., with what brushes or tools to use. Tell me how to apply brow enhancers without looking like a kid with crayons drew them for me. I would like to hear the nitty gritty basics, because I went for decades without wearing any more than a soft lip balm, but now I’m old enough that I should have learned these things and been applying them for a dozen years or more! I can’t be the only one who buys these lovely products but has no clue as to the basics of applying them correctly. Help! And thanks!

@bikerxena Lisa Eldridge has "Make-Up Basics" videos that are perfect for beginners. She's a phenomenal artist, and as an added bonus, her voice is lovely and soothing. There are specific videos for primer, foundation, concealer, contour, blush, etc., and as you get more confident you can move into some of her other tutorials. Highly recommended!
